Tottenham Hotspur vs Brentford – Match Preview and Team News

Tottenham Hotspur manager Thomas Frank prepares for an emotional reunion with his former club, Brentford, on Saturday afternoon.

He looks to arrest a dismal run of form that has plagued his new side in North London. Spurs return to the Tottenham Hotspur Stadium in crisis mode. In fact, they have won just three of their 16 Premier League home games in 2025. This is their lowest win rate across a calendar year in their league history.

They face a Brentford side that is also struggling on the road. The Bees have lost six away games this season, which is more than any other side in the division. However, they arrive with renewed hope after becoming the second London team to face Arsenal and Tottenham away consecutively. Consequently, this London derby offers a critical opportunity for both desperate teams to turn the tide.

Tottenham Hotspur vs Brentford – Match Preview and Team News

  • Date: Saturday, 6 December 2025
  • Kick-off: 15:00 GMT
  • Venue: Tottenham Hotspur Stadium, London
  • Referee: Robert Jones
  • VAR: Timothy Wood
  • Last Meeting: Brentford 0-2 Tottenham Hotspur, 2 February 2025, Premier League

Team News

Tottenham Hotspur

Thomas Frank has received a massive boost with Micky van de Ven named in the probable starting XI. This suggests the Dutchman has recovered sufficiently from the hamstring scare that threatened to keep him out. He will partner Cristian Romero, who is available again after suspension.

However, the attack remains reshuffled due to injuries to Dominic Solanke and Richarlison. Therefore, Randal Kolo Muani is expected to lead the line. He will be supported by Mohammed Kudus. Lucas Bergvall continues in midfield in the absence of James Maddison.

Brentford

Brentford boss Keith Andrews is navigating a difficult schedule. He will rely heavily on striker Igor Thiago. The Brazilian has been a revelation despite the team’s struggles. Thiago has scored nine goals in his last eight Premier League starts. Crucially, those strikes directly earned eight points for the Bees. Keane Lewis-Potter is expected to start at left-back. Sepp van den Berg and Nathan Collins will anchor the defence.

Form

Tottenham Hotspur

Spurs are enduring a torrid spell. They have lost their last three Premier League London derbies. Furthermore, they have lost each of their last four such matches at home. Consequently, they are in danger of setting an unwanted record. They have never lost five consecutive home derbies in their league history. Their 10 home defeats in 2025 is already a joint-high for the club.

Brentford

The Bees have struggled in the capital. They have won just three of their last 16 Premier League London derbies. Interestingly, all three of those victories came away from home. This offers a glimmer of hope for Saturday. However, their away form this season is a major concern. Only Wolves have picked up fewer points on the road than Brentford.

Predicted Lineups

Tottenham Hotspur predicted XI: Vicario; Porro, Romero, Van de Ven, Udogie; Sarr, Bentancur; Kudus, Bergvall, Johnson; Kolo Muani

Brentford predicted XI: Kelleher; Kayode, Collins, Van den Berg, Lewis-Potter; Yarmolyuk, Henderson; Ouattara, Damsgaard, Schade; Thiago

How to watch Tottenham Hotspur vs Brentford?

This match will not be broadcast live in the UK due to the 15:00 GMT Saturday blackout. Highlights will be available on BBC’s Match of the Day at 22:30 GMT.
